Abstract
The vortex phase transition was systematically studied in twin-free for various δ. For the first order transition was evidenced by an abrupt jump and a hysteresis of magnetization in the field-cooled (FC) cooling-warming cycles, which indicates the coexistence of vortex crystallites and liquid. For the jump was not sharp and FC magnetization was reversible, suggesting a second order transition. The first and the second order transitions merge at a critical point (CP) which goes to zero field for Three-dimensional XY scaling satisfactorily fits the data at 1–7 T for and for but does not fit for where the CP passes through this field range.
